Is Brownsville TX The poorest city?
Brownsville, Texas, sits high in the rankings where cities want to come in low. It’s the poorest city in America, with 36 percent of its residents living in poverty. (By contrast, the poverty level in the nation’s richest city, San Jose, California, is 10.8 percent.)
How many people speak Spanish in Brownsville Texas?
14.28% of Brownsville residents speak only English, while 85.72% speak other languages. The non-English language spoken by the largest group is Spanish, which is spoken by 84.76% of the population.

What is Brownsville TX famous for?
It is the 131st-largest city in the United States and 18th-largest in Texas. It is part of the Matamoros–Brownsville metropolitan area. The city is known for its year-round subtropical climate, deep-water seaport, and Hispanic culture.

Is Brownsville Texas Low income?
The estimated median household income in Brownsville is only $29,619 per year. This is well below even Texas’ median income, which is $50,740.

What county is Brownsville Texas in?
Brownsville (/ˈbrɑːʊnzˌvɪl/) is a city in Cameron County in the U.S. state of Texas. It is located on the western Gulf Coast in South Texas, adjacent to the border with Matamoros, Mexico.
